Position Responsibilities

As the Master of Towing, you will have overall responsibility for the safe and efficient operation of the vessel, including:

  • Ensuring the safety and welfare of all crew members.
  • Directing all vessel operations, including navigation and towing activities.
  • Supervising vessel maintenance and ensuring equipment reliability.
  • Managing crew schedules, training, and performance.
  • Coordinating vessel movements and daily operations.
  • Monitoring weather, navigational, and environmental conditions.
  • Maintaining compliance with all Coast Guard regulations and company policies.
  • Promoting a strong culture of safety, teamwork, and operational excellence.

Qualifications

  • Master of Towing License
  • Minimum 200 GRT with Great Lakes or Near Coastal Endorsement
  • Valid U.S. Coast Guard Medical Certificate
  • STCW Not Required
  • Must be eligible to enter Canada (No DUI convictions)

Experience

  • Previous experience as a Captain/Master on wire tugboats required.
  • Experience with astern towing (wire towing) required.
  • Great Lakes operating experience preferred.
  • Candidates with strong towing backgrounds who need Great Lakes recency will be considered.
